5. The Revolution Ahead
The last few years have seen rapid transformation in many areas like: -
Scalable and profitable retail models are well established for most of the categories
Indian consumers are rapidly evolving and accepting modern formats overwhelmingly
Retail space is no more a constraint for growth
India is on the radar of global retailers
Suppliers / brands are willing to partner with retailers
Notwithstanding some stumbling blocks, no one can mistake the immense potential of the boom in the domestic retail sector.
Given the size and the purchasing power of the Indian consumer, the road ahead can only get smoother and it is only a matter of time before the domestic retail industry is on par with its western counterparts.
